Bruce Irvin would take discount to return to Seahawks

bruceirvin

Bruce Irvin is set to become a free agent but the linebacker would welcome a return to the Seahawks, the team which drafted him.

According to the Seattle Times, Irvin may take $3-5 million less over the course of his next deal to return to the Seahawks.

“I’m not asking for $100 million,’’ Irvin was quoted as saying. “I’m not asking for nothing crazy. I just want to be appreciated. But everything will work itself out.’’

The Seahawks declined his fifth-year option on his rookie deal but Irvin is not quite ready to rule anyone out as he hits the free market. Many are already linking Irvin to the Falcons who hired former Seahawks defensive coordinator Dan Quinn.

The 28-year-old Irvin recorded 5.5 sacks last season and was in on 38 tackles. For his career he has 21.5 sacks across four seasons.
